AAFCO nutritional adequacy
Complete & balanced Whether the manufacturer's label claims the food meets AAFCO nutrient profiles for a life stage. Not an independent test.
Yes Yes
Life stages Adult Maintenance All Life Stages
Substantiation How adequacy was established. Feeding trials are the higher bar; formulation means the recipe is calculated to meet the profile.
Formulation Formulation
Maker standards
WSAVA guidelines The World Small Animal Veterinary Association publishes criteria for evaluating a manufacturer: qualified nutritionists on staff, feeding trials, and published research. It does not certify or endorse brands.
No No
PSC accredited The Pet Sustainability Coalition is a nonprofit that accredits pet companies on their environmental and social impact through third-party verification. It reflects sustainability practices, not food quality.
No Yes
